The FAN7380 is a monolithic half-bridge gate drive IC for
MOSFETs and IGBTs, which operate up to +600V.
Fairchild’s high-voltage process and common-mode
noise canceling technique give stable operation of high-
side driver under high-dv/dt noise circumstances. An
advanced level-shift circuit allows high-side gate driver
operation up to VS=-9.8V (typical) for VBS=15V. The
